  • Bacterial starter cultures as a basis for the development of probiotic fish products

    Lavrukhina, E.V.; Zarubin, N.Yu.; Bredikhina, O.V.; Grinevich, A.I. (Russian Federal Research Institute of Fisheries and Oceanography (VNIRO), 2022)
    In food biotechnology, special attention is paid to biotransformation of bacterial starter cultures by promising strains for obtaining food products with improved quality characteristics and functionality. Bacterial starters can be used in biotransformation to increase the storage life of fish products, improving their organoleptic characteristics and increasing their nutritional value due to the formation of their life activity metabolites, which are the main factor of bioconservation and synthesis of vitamins and other biologically active substances. Probiotic characteristics of bacterial starter cultures have a significant impact on optimization of the microbiological status of the human digestive tract, which helps to stimulate the immune system and maintain a healthy lifestyle. The use of industrially valuable strains of bioprotective probiotic microorganisms is a promising biotechnological trend. This trend is related to the interest of the population of the Russian Federation in probiotic products.

  • Assessment of intraspecific composition of regional groups of juvenile chum salmon (Oncorhynchus keta) in the Sea of Okhotsk in the autumn of 2019

    Denisenko, A.D.; Pilganchuk, O.A.; Zikunova, O.V.; Muravskaya, U.O.; Savenkov, V.V.; Shpigalskaya, N.Yu. (Russian Federal Research Institute of Fisheries and Oceanography (VNIRO), 2022)
    The population and genetic structure of chum salmon in the main reproduction regions of the Russian Far East is presented based on the variability of eight microsatellite loci (Ssa20.19, One101, Oke3, Oki1b, Oki23, Ogo2G, Oke11, Ots102). Four main regional groups have been identified for the purposes of genetic identification. The accuracy of the estimates obtained is calculated for each of the four groups. The authors present the results of genetic identification according to the autumn trawl survey in the Sea of Okhotsk in 2019.
  • Assessment of the influence of temperature on the formation of the Eastern and Western Kamchatka pink salmon population in different life periods

    Dederer, N.A.; Shevlyakov, E.A. (Russian Federal Research Institute of Fisheries and Oceanography (VNIRO), 2022)
    The article presents the results of a comparative analysis of some databases describing SST (sea surface temperature) along the coast of Western Kamchatka with data from domestic weather stations carried out in the villages of Bolsheretsk, Icha, Sobolevo and Ozernovsky. These weather stations monitored air temperature and, in some years, water temperature in adjacent coastal areas. Databases ("10-days-SST", "MGDSST", "HIMSST") that adequately describe the actual curves of water temperature in the coastal area and air temperature in the area of concentration of the main spawning water basins and watercourses (ECMWF V5) have been identified. The selected databases were used to develop long-term series of temperature characteristics in the Kamchatka mainland and some areas of the Bering and Okhotsk Seas used by Western and Northeastern Kamchatka pink salmon at different stages of its life cycle.
  • Comparative analysis of fish-farming and biological indicators of male Siberian sturgeon in the second stage of sexual maturity

    Vorobiev, A.P. (Russian Federal Research Institute of Fisheries and Oceanography (VNIRO), 2022)
    The article presents the comparative results of two-year experimental works on obtaining sexual products from male Siberian sturgeons in conditions of a straight-flow basin industrial enterprise with annual total amount of 5500 degree-days are presented. The fish-farming, biological and morphological characteristics of the producers, their comparative indicators of the quality of sexual products, histological characteristics of the initial state of the gonads are given. It has been noted that the body weight and sperm movement time in Siberian sturgeon increase with age by 41.1 and 12.0 %, more ejaculate is produced by 21.8 %, the visual quality of sperm improves by 27.0 %, but the relative fecundity decreases by 11.6 %.
  • Assessment of the effect of absence of spawning on the fish-farming and biological characteristics of Siberian sturgeon Acipenser baerii (Brandt, 1869) offspring

    Vorobiev, A.P. (Russian Federal Research Institute of Fisheries and Oceanography (VNIRO), 2022)
    The article presents the results of studies on the effect of spawning season absence of female Siberian sturgeon of the Lena population on the fish-biological characteristics of the experimental group, as well as the grown-up juveniles in the conditions of industrial farms. The offspring of experimental females that underwent the resorption process, despite the lowest weight of embryos at hatching, maintained a high growth rate throughout the entire rearing period, comparable with juveniles of control groups.
  • Species diversity and relative number of the fingerlings in the Meshinsky Bay of the Kuibyshev Reservoir

    Kuzyuk, A.V.; Maidanov, K.V. (Russian Federal Research Institute of Fisheries and Oceanography (VNIRO), 2022)
    The article provides data analysis on the species composition and relative number of the fingerlings in the Meshinsky Bay of the Volga-Kama Reach of the Kuibyshev Reservoir during the research period from 2019 to 2021. The total number of species in the studied years was 19, among them the bleak, the Black Sea puffy-cheeked needle-fish, roach and the Black Sea-Caspian seal were dominant. The highest value of the Shannon Diversity index was noted in 2020.
